Technical field
The utility model belongs to tyre removing and replacing machine technical field, in particular to exempting from crowbar tyre retreading operation, and the lower and trouble-proof tire of any dismounting of crowbar aspect ratio can be exempted from, avoid the automatic tire retreading working head of a kind of tyre removing and replacing machine tire and tire toe being caused to stealthy injury.
Background technology
In prior art, after tyre removing and replacing machine clamping tire, dismounting head rest is at the upper limb of wheel hub, be inserted between tyre rim and dismounting head front portion with crowbar, with the another side of hand pressing crowbar, tyre rim is prized on dismounting head front portion, this operation very effort and be not that very skilled new operator has certain danger to operation, especially lower to some aspect ratios tire, wanting to realize this, to tear tire process open more difficult.Application number is
cN200920203668.0utility model disclose one and exempt from crowbar tyre removing and replacing machine, on the basis of conventional tyre removing machine structure, in casing, 3 cylinders are installed at rear portion, 3 cylinders are connected with left skateboard, upper right slide plate and bottom right slide plate by bolt, box type column both sides arrange left and right chute board, working head and lower cone pulley are connected on upper right slide plate and bottom right slide plate, and upper right, lower skateboard are slidably mounted on right chute board.This utility model Problems existing is, need to drive sliding 3 the slide plate actions in left skateboard, upper right slide plate and bottom right with 3 cylinders, complex structure, volume is larger, and the left and right chute board that box type column both sides are arranged is rectangle slideway, working head can only straight up and down move, and is difficult to the difficulty solving the lower tyre-disassembling of aspect ratio.
The application number that Yingkou Tongda Auto Maintenance Equipment Co., Ltd. proposes is
cN201220163367.1utility model disclose exempt from crowbar displacement tear tire working head open, comprise the location be fixedly mounted on tyre removing and replacing machine six square shaft and tear tire working head open, location is torn open tire working head and is connected with in the middle part of swing arm by connecting rod I, the lower end of swing arm is provided with displacement and tears tire working head open, swing arm upper end is connected with the cylinder rod of tyre removing and replacing machine by connecting rod II, existing location is torn open tire working head technology and is torn tire working head open with displacement and combine by this utility model, achieve and exempting under crowbar state, to complete the pressure tire to wheel tyre, pine tire, hook tire and tear the operation of tire open, namely the collateral damage that tire carries out dismounting operation is avoided, substantially increase again dismounting operating speed and the efficiency of tire.But, this utility model Problems existing is, tearing tire working head open with air cylinder device is separate to assemble, and installs complicated, debug difficulties, especially the angle of its tyre retreading hook is large, is 70 ~ 80 degree, and it is shallow that its tyre retreading hooks groove, be 5 ~ 10mm, easily occur tread flaking and hook the problem of not coming up, the hook tire for runflat is more undesirable, occurs the phenomenon of tread flaking sometimes.
Summary of the invention
Technical problem to be solved in the utility model is, overcome the deficiencies in the prior art part, there is provided and can exempt from crowbar tyre retreading operation, and the lower tire of any dismounting of crowbar aspect ratio can be exempted from, avoid the automatic tire retreading working head of a kind of tyre removing and replacing machine tire and tire toe being caused to stealthy injury.
The technical scheme that the utility model is taked comprises dismounting head, fixed mount, connecting rod and tyre retreading hook, described fixed mount is by left adapter plate, right adapter plate, front connecting panel and base plate welding are integrally formed, base plate and horizontal plane angle are α, air cylinder device is connected with right adapter plate upper end the first hexagonal bar iron at left adapter plate, dismounting head is fixedly connected with at the lower end right flank of fixed mount, arcuate guide slideway is processed with in the middle part of the left adapter plate and right adapter plate of fixed mount, be provided with on tyre retreading hooks and hook tire groove, and the first connecting shaft hole and the second connecting shaft hole two axis holes are processed with on tyre retreading hooks, the rear axis hole of connecting rod is connected with fixed mount by the second hexagonal bar iron, the first connecting shaft hole that front-axle hole on connecting rod is hooked by bearing pin and tyre retreading is connected, the second connecting shaft hole that tyre retreading hooks is connected with oscillating bearing by adapter shaft, oscillating bearing realizes being threaded with the tapped bore that the cylinder rod of air cylinder device is processed, described adapter shaft is through the arcuate guide slideway in the middle part of the left adapter plate of fixed mount and right adapter plate, lock at the right-hand member jam nut of adapter shaft, the second connecting shaft hole that tyre retreading hooks is sleeved on the adapter shaft between left adapter plate and right adapter plate.
Described base plate and horizontal plane angle are the angle of α is 30 ~ 35 degree.
Assembly wrench valve and handle on described air cylinder device, hand pulls valve realizes being hooked by oscillating bearing, the second hexagonal bar iron, bearing pin, connecting rod and tyre retreading the connecting rod mechanism formed motion by the air-channel system of control cylinder device.
Described dismounting head is precision castings.
The groove depth of described hook tire groove is 15 ~ 20mm, and the angle hooking tire groove is 50 ~ 60 degree.
Compared with prior art, the beneficial effects of the utility model are:
(1) mechanical linkage owing to adopting, the utility model makes operator in the process of tearing tire open, eliminates the process with crowbar upwards tyre retreading, reduces working strength; And while solving the lower tyre-disassembling difficulty of aspect ratio, avoid the limitation of crowbar dismounting, make the action of sled tire can be incremental, whole process can stop at any time, be convenient to observe tire force situation, thus carry out accommodation;
(2) connect because the utility model only has a connecting rod and tyre retreading to link, cylinder rod up-and-down movement is stressed less, motion freely, especially to tyre retreading hook profile and angle improve, tyre retreading hook hook tire groove less than former angle, ditch groove depth, not easily tread flaking when making hook tire groove catch on tire, the power upwards acted on for the low and trouble-proof tire of aspect ratio is little, solves that the angle that tyre retreading hooks is large, groove is shallow, easily occurs tread flaking and hooks the problem of not coming up.

Detailed description of the invention
As shown in Fig. 1 ~ Fig. 7, the utility model comprises dismounting 1, fixed mount 10, connecting rod 14 and tyre retreading hook 15, described dismounting 1 is precision castings, dismounting 1 is processed with 4 dismounting head axis holes, described fixed mount 10 is by left adapter plate 10-1, right adapter plate 10-2, front connecting panel 10-3 and base plate 10-4 welding is integrally formed, base plate 10-4 and horizontal plane angle are α, the angle of α is 30 ~ 35 degree, bolt hole 10-5 is processed with at left adapter plate 10-1 and right adapter plate 10-2 upper end correspondence, air cylinder device 9 is connected by this bolt hole 10-5 the first hexagonal bar iron 6, 4 the tapped bore 10-6s corresponding with 4 axis holes that dismounting 1 is processed are processed with at the lower end right flank of fixed mount 10, dismounting 1 is fixedly connected on fixed mount 10 by 4 hexagon socket countersunk flat cap head screws 2, arcuate guide slideway 10-7 is processed with in the middle part of the left adapter plate 10-1 and right adapter plate 10-2 of fixed mount 10, described connecting rod 14 is processed with front-axle hole and rear axis hole 2 axis holes, as shown in Figure 8, tyre retreading hook 15 is being provided with hook tire groove 15-3, the groove depth of described hook tire groove is 15 ~ 20mm, the angle hooking tire groove is 50 ~ 60 degree, and the first connecting shaft hole 15-1 and the second connecting shaft hole 15-2 two axis holes are processed with on tyre retreading hook 15, the rear axis hole of connecting rod 14 is connected with fixed mount 10 by the second hexagonal bar iron 12, front-axle hole on connecting rod 14 is connected with the first connecting shaft hole 15-1 that tyre retreading hooks 15 by bearing pin 13, second connecting shaft hole 15-2 of tyre retreading hook 15 is connected with oscillating bearing 11 by adapter shaft 4, oscillating bearing 11 realizes being threaded with the tapped bore that the cylinder rod of air cylinder device 9 is processed, described adapter shaft 4 is through the arcuate guide slideway 10-7 in the middle part of the left adapter plate 10-1 of fixed mount 10 and right adapter plate 10-2, at the right-hand member suit gear pad 3 of adapter shaft 4, and lock with jam nut 5, second connecting shaft hole 15-2 of tyre retreading hook 15 is sleeved on the adapter shaft 4 between left adapter plate 10-1 and right adapter plate 10-2, assembly wrench valve 8 and handle 7 on air cylinder device 9, hand is pulled valve 8 and is realized by oscillating bearing 11 by the air-channel system of control cylinder device 9, second hexagonal bar iron 12, bearing pin 13, connecting rod 14 and tyre retreading hook the motion of the connecting rod mechanism that 15 are formed.
During use, automatic tire retreading working head mechanism integrally, be fixed on six square shafts of tyre detacher by dismounting 1, spanner valve 8 is by the up-and-down movement of air-channel system control cylinder device 9, the up-and-down movement track that tyre retreading hooks 15 is that the oscillating bearing 11 making to be connected to cylinder rod front end by the up-and-down movement of air cylinder device 9 reciprocatingly slides with the arcuate guide slideway 10-7 of adapter shaft 4 on fixed mount hooking the hole of 15-1 through oscillating bearing 11 and tyre retreading, and under the combined action of connecting rod 14, tyre retreading is made to hook 15 up-and-down movements, tyre retreading hook 15 enters into the inner side of bead of tyre when moving downward, during upward movement, the inner side of bead is caught on by the tyre retreading hook tire groove 15-3 hooked on 15, tire is ticked wheel hub, tire is clamped by four claws on the large disc assembly of motor-belt-drop-gear box-deep bid assembly apparatus, the rotating of motor is controlled by foot-operated switch, drive the rotating of large disc assembly to realize the process of dismounting.
